초록

A process for the preparation of toner compositions comprising: forming a mixture comprised of at least one free radical reactive monomer, a colorant, a stabilizer compound containing a stable free radical reactive group, and a liquid vehicle; and heating the mixture from about 75°to about 200°C. to
